Superdeep: A Soviet Horror Descent — Full Movie Info

Deep beneath Soviet-era Russia in 1984, a determined research team led by a determined scientist descends into the Kola Superdeep Borehole, the deepest artificial point on Earth, seeking answers locked away for decades. What begins as a high-stakes scientific expedition spirals into a claustrophobic nightmare when the team encounters something far beyond scientific explanation—something that doesn't want to be found. Directed with gritty atmosphere by Arseny Syukhin, Superdeep (2020) blends horror, science fiction, and psychological tension into a chilling meditation on human curiosity and the unknown depths within—and beneath—our world.

As communication falters and the darkness presses in, paranoia and dread set in among the crew. Milena Radulović anchors the ensemble as the resilient lead, while Sergey Ivanuk and Nicholay Kovbas deliver powerful performances that heighten the film's oppressive realism. With its stark visuals and relentless suspense, Superdeep (2020) is a genre-defying descent into terror, where the real monsters may not wear teeth, but silence.
